I had this cannot connect to server issue first time setting up a rift on win7 64bit. Proceeding with Timothy3.14's fix worked for me.
This thread comes up first in a google search so I felt like I should share what fixed the issue on my system.

Please note: this is what was required for my win7 64bit system.
By updating to KB2858728 the Oculus setup software indicated my system needed KB2670838
and KB3033929 to proceed with setup.

I tried EVERYTHING on this list. In the end I kept feeling that it was the disk space issue even though I had over 6 GB's of free space on my my C:\ drive. This because I felt the installer didnt't even try to connect with anything. It went straight to no connection every time. So I decided to free up some more space and when I had 7.5 Gb's... It worked! So keep in mind that the 5GB's might not be enough for everybody, or maybe the data to be downloaded is bigger nowadays. Go for 10 GB if you want to be sure!
